Choosing a 100W USB-C Cable: Why INIU's 2-Pack Stands Out

If you're looking to charge a MacBook Pro, iPad Pro, or even the latest iPhone 17 at full speed, a 100W USB-C cable is essential. The INIU USB C to USB C Cable, offered in a 2-pack with 1m+1m lengths, promises high-speed Power Delivery (PD) charging in a durable nylon braided design. Here's what you need to know before buying.

Key Considerations Before Buying

  • Power Delivery (PD) support is critical for fast charging devices like laptops and tablets—ensure the cable is rated for at least 60W for phones and 100W for laptops to avoid slow charging.
  • Cable length matters: 1-meter cables are ideal for portable use with power banks, while longer lengths (like 2m) are better for wall charging from a distance. This 2-pack includes two 1m cables, which suits desk or bag setups.
  • Durability is key for USB-C cables, as they endure frequent bending. Look for braided nylon jackets and reinforced connectors, like those on the INIU cable, to prevent fraying.

What Our Analysts Recommend

Quality USB-C cables should have e-marker chips for safe 100W charging, which negotiate power delivery between devices. Also, check for USB-IF certification for guaranteed compliance. The INIU cable's braided design and 100W rating signal solid build, but verify it supports data transfer speeds (e.g., USB 2.0 or 3.0) if needed.

USB Cables Market Context

Market Overview

The USB-C cable market is crowded with options ranging from cheap, uncertified cables to premium, high-power models. With devices like the iPhone 17 and MacBook Pro moving to USB-C, demand for 100W PD cables has surged, making quality differentiation critical.

Common Issues

Many USB-C cables fail to deliver advertised wattage due to poor wiring or missing e-markers, leading to slow charging or device damage. Counterfeit cables also pose safety risks, such as overheating or short circuits, especially at high power levels.

Quality Indicators

Look for cables with 56kΩ resistors (for safety), USB-IF certification, and a minimum 100W PD rating for laptop charging. Braided nylon jackets and aluminum connector housings are signs of durability, while user reviews mentioning long-term use (e.g., 'over a year') add trust.
